Add rich preview support for three new file categories by leveraging external CLI tools with graceful fallback when tools are missing. - PDF: text extraction via pdftotext, page count via pdfinfo - Audio: metadata via ffprobe (duration, bitrate, codec, sample rate, channels) - Video: metadata via ffprobe (duration, bitrate, video/audio codec, resolution) - New PreviewKind constants: PDF, Audio, Video - New Metadata fields for extended preview data - New extension maps and Category() entries for pdf/audio/video - Icons: PDF (), audio (), video () in preview header Closes #5

## 12. Edge Cases & Considerations
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
- **Missing external tool**: If `pdftotext` or `ffprobe` is not installed, the user sees a helpful message telling them which package to install, and the preview falls back to `PreviewKindBinary` (same as before).
|
||||||
|
- **Large PDFs**: Text extraction respects `MaxPreviewBytes` limit — truncated output is still highlighted.
|
||||||
|
- **Corrupt files**: `ffprobe` and `pdftotext` handle errors gracefully; any non-zero exit returns `PreviewKindError` with the error message.
|
||||||
|
- **Performance**: External processes are launched synchronously in the preview command (which already runs in a goroutine via `loadPreviewCmd()`), so the UI remains responsive.
|
||||||
|
- **No new dependencies**: All tools are invoked via `os/exec` (stdlib). No Go modules needed.
